Oct. 4, 2012 Children's Fishing Derby at Branch Pond Nov. 17 In 1968, Branch Memorial Park and Pond were constructed and named in honor of Maj. Gen. Irving L. "Twig" Branch who was killed when his T-38 crashed into Pugent Sound, Wash., in 1966. Branch was commander of the Air Force Flight Test Center from 1961 until the time of his crash. Construction was

July 2, 2013 Chilean C-130 lands at Edwards, picks up radars Two SENTINEL radar systems are loaded onto a Chilean C-130 July 1 at Edwards Air Force Base as part of a foreign military sales case for Chile. Chile intends to use the radars to modernize its armed forces by expanding its existing air defense architecture to counter threats posed by air attack. The
